Output d3290e08dcf8579d7f02ad47928f8e6470b17208088c368e6678031ccf368633:0

value
52850230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39ab65196ffb7b2a8bfdca6e62aa933743b8c089 OP_EQUAL
address
2MxW9pwpoGpqDjxUeNnQ4U3XiXAexrRoUpH
transaction
d3290e08dcf8579d7f02ad47928f8e6470b17208088c368e6678031ccf368633